分布式计算是优化数据中心性能的关键技术,它通过将大型计算任务分解为多个小型任务,分散到多台计算机上进行并行处理,从而提高了计算效率和处理速度。在机房中,分布式机组的应用可以实现资源的高效利用,提高数据中心的稳定性和可靠性,同时也降低了能耗和维护成本。
本文目录导读:
在当前的数字化时代,数据已经成为企业的核心资产,随着大数据、人工智能、云计算等技术的发展,企业对数据处理能力的需求越来越高,为了满足这些需求,许多企业开始采用机房分布式计算技术,以提高数据中心的性能和可扩展性,本文将对机房分布式计算的概念、优势以及实施方法进行详细介绍。
机房分布式计算概念
机房分布式计算是一种将计算任务分散到多个服务器上进行处理的技术,通过将计算任务分解为多个子任务,并将这些子任务分配给不同的服务器进行处理,可以有效地提高计算速度和处理能力,分布式计算的核心思想是将大型计算任务分解为多个小型任务,然后通过多台计算机协同工作来完成任务。
机房分布式计算优势
1、提高计算性能:分布式计算可以将计算任务分散到多个服务器上进行处理,从而大大提高了计算性能,尤其是在处理大量数据时,分布式计算可以显著提高计算速度和处理能力。
2、提高系统可扩展性:分布式计算可以根据业务需求灵活地增加或减少服务器数量,从而实现系统的可扩展性,这意味着企业可以根据业务需求快速调整计算资源,以满足不断变化的数据处理需求。
3、提高系统可靠性:分布式计算通过将计算任务分散到多个服务器上进行处理,可以有效地提高系统的可靠性,当某个服务器出现故障时,其他服务器可以继续处理该服务器的任务,从而保证整个系统的正常运行。
4、降低能耗:分布式计算可以通过合理地分配计算任务,降低单个服务器的负载,从而降低能耗,这对于数据中心来说具有重要的意义,因为数据中心的能耗通常占企业总能耗的很大一部分。
机房分布式计算实施方法
1、选择合适的分布式计算框架:根据企业的业务需求和技术背景,选择合适的分布式计算框架,目前市场上有许多成熟的分布式计算框架,如Hadoop、Spark、Flink等,企业可以根据自己的需求选择合适的框架。
2、设计合理的计算任务划分策略:根据计算任务的特点,设计合理的任务划分策略,任务划分策略的设计需要考虑到计算任务的大小、复杂性、并行性等因素,以确保分布式计算能够充分发挥其优势。
3、部署和配置分布式计算环境:根据计算任务的规模和需求,部署和配置合适的分布式计算环境,这包括选择合适的服务器硬件、操作系统、网络设备等,以及安装和配置分布式计算框架。
机房分布式计算是一种有效的提高数据中心性能的技术,通过将计算任务分散到多个服务器上进行处理,分布式计算可以显著提高计算速度和处理能力,同时提高系统的可扩展性和可靠性,企业应根据自身的业务需求和技术背景,选择合适的分布式计算框架和实施方法,以充分利用分布式计算的优势。